Last month, Novak announced that Russia would voluntarily cut oil production by 500,000 barrels per day in March, or about 5% of the production level, in response to price cap measures imposed by Western countries on Russian energy. At that time, this news once pushed up the international crude oil price.
In his latest statement, Novak wrote that Russia had come close to this commitment to reduce output and would achieve the reduced production level in the coming days, without giving further details. He added that this level of production would be maintained until the end of June.
